Analytic study on backreacting holographic superconductors with dark matter sector
arXiv:1411.0798 · doi:10.1103/PhysRevD.90.106004
Abstract
The variational method for Sturm-Liouville eigenvalue problem was employed to study analytically properties of the holographic superconductor with dark matter sector, in which a coupling between Maxwell field and another U(1)-gauge field was considered. The backreaction of the dark matter sector on gravitational background in question was also examined.
